Road Rules

Posted on April 11, 2025April 11, 2025 by Virtual Afro Woman

     As I am sitting here, I am set to work this Friday to end the second week of April. To get to work, I drive my car. I live fairly close to work, but I leave an hour earlier for my sanity. I like to do this to sit in my car and relax before I begin my work day. But ultimately, I do this so that my traffic won’t be too much of a headache. I don’t know if it’s just me, if it’s New York City (NYC) as a whole, or if it’s everywhere, but driving is no longer fun for me and having a chauffeur would be amazing at this point

    Number One for why driving is no longer fun….

    People are crazy. I use this word to mean unbalanced. People are running red lights. People are turning or cutting you off with no signal. The electric scooter and bike riders are reckless. We have traffic lights and crosswalks, and some pedestrians act as if they can’t wait for the light to be in their favor. Your vision has to be all over the place. If you don’t get a headache or stressed by this, you are lucky.

    Number Two for why driving is no longer fun…

    The people in control of changing street signs and the directions of streets, I sometimes wonder about them. These changes often cause more traffic in my eye. Do they just sit in their office drinking coffee looking at the streets like a chess board, and decide how to take out the opponent. There’s no reason why sometimes you have to go 6 blocks to make one turn onto a street.

    Number Three for why driving is no longer fun…

     Traffic! It can be road blocks due to construction. The people who have insurance company monitors for speed/brake use. It may be the people distracted by their phones behind the wheel. Then there are the people who like sightseeing as they drive, going 10 miles per hour, holding up traffic.

     This has been my mental release for this day. For now, I have to continue to drive myself to work. It’s still more convenient over taking public transportation. I hope all of you who gave to work today had or have a good and safe commute. Happy Friday to you all!
